Well here goes with my card

 
Ingredients
 
Well an assortment of bits from here and there
Card could Hunkydory or Kanban
Pink satin effect backing card from Create and Craft
Bootee image a download from Cuddly Buddly
Coloured with Promarkers and bow glittered
Gingham card Forever Friend New Arrival Paper Pad
Sentiments and peel offs from stash
 
Again Pink bootees have shown up a bit bright but is OK in real life.
